Back in 1975, Luther, was a five-person group. Luther the album was released in 1976 and the group’s final album, This Close to You, in 1977.
All tracks on both albums were written by Luther proving that LOVE and all that goes along with it, was always his message. The Luther album also features the song “Everybody Rejoice” a song of jubilance, resurgence, and freedom! It’s used in the movie and stage performances of the critically acclaimed and seven-time Tony winner, The Wiz.

Luther: Never Too Much, the feature-length documentary on Luther Vandross’s life and career, is premiering at the 2024 Sundance Film Festival.
From award-winning filmmaker Dawn Porter, the film follows the iconic artist as he charted his own course becoming one of the most influential pop artists of all time.

Luther Vandross — Live at Radio City Music Hall 2003 — Expanded 20th Anniversary Edition — The Last Concert. This album celebrates the 20th Anniversary of Luther’s iconic sold-out shows at Radio City Music Hall. The expanded edition features the entire concert in original set order, including 4 new tracks: “Power of Love/Love Power,” “Going Out of My Head,” “Any Day Now,” and “Say It Now,” and Luther’s on-stage banter. FANDROSS proudly announces Luther Vandross has been inducted into the Smithsonian National Museum of African American History and Culture, Musical Crossroads section!

It’s incredible to know that Luther’s musical contributions to the world are now memorialized among the other greats that will be enjoyed for generations to come.

His display is stunning, dramatic and gorgeous. It has his eye-catching red, black and crystal sequenced Art Deco stage jacket and was created by fashion designer Tony Chase. It's a striking reminder of the beauty, elegance and refined showmanship he created for his audiences worldwide.

The case also contains Luther’s own hand-written lyric sheet for his Grammy winning song "Dance With My Father" in addition to the only microphone he used to record his studio albums.

Suit Jacket Worn by Luther Vandross

Suit Jacket, Gowns, Jacket, Sony Studio Microphone Credit:  Gift of Seveda Williams in Celebration of the Musical Legacy of her Uncle, Luther Vandross
“The entire family is bursting with a wonderful sense of pride and joy. This is an honor we will cherish always.”

.

“Dance With My Father” Hand-Written Lyrics Credit: Gift of Fonzi Thornton in Memory of Luther Vandross
https://fandross.com/wp-content/uploads/2022/09/Luther-Costumes.jpeg-scaled.jpg

Stage Attire Worn by Luther and His Backing Vocalists (Kevin Owens, Ava Cherry, Lisa Fischer) During the Power of Love Tour in 1991-1992 and at the New Orleans Superdome in 1993 on the Never Let Me Go Tour
